Residential Appraisal Desk Reviewer Collateral Risk Solutions is seeking Residential Appraisal Desk Reviewers with nationwide desk review experience (USPAP and non-USPAP compliant reports).  

 

Mandatory requirements include:  

• Minimum three years nationwide appraisal review experience where compensation has been based on production

• Experience with appraisal risk assessment for secondary market

• Ability to identify fraud signs & overvaluation techniques

• Ability to effectively utilize data search tools including RealQuest and various MLS boards

• Detailed written/verbal communication skills and proficiency in Outlook, Adobe and Word required

• Appraisal License/Certification (certification preferred – must be in good standing)

 

This job requires flexible hours. Occasional overtime may be required and weekends.
